How much does it cost to get to Cross Border Xpress (CBX) from Los Angeles?
In general, a ticket between Cross Border Xpress (CBX) and Los Angeles costs about $46. The trip is offered by Los Limousines and takes about 4h 48m. Keep in mind that prices may vary depending on the mode of transportation, time of day, and season.
What companies travel to Cross Border Xpress (CBX)?
You can travel with Los Limousines to get to Cross Border Xpress (CBX). The company offers 428 daily trips, with the earliest bus leaving at 12:05am and the last bus leaving at 11:54pm.
